Title: Choosing the Best ReactJS Development Company for Your Project

In the ever-evolving landscape of web development, ReactJS has emerged as one of the most popular and powerful JavaScript libraries for building user interfaces. Its component-based architecture, virtual DOM, and reusability have made it a top choice for companies looking to create dynamic and interactive web applications. However, harnessing the full potential of ReactJS often requires the expertise of a skilled development team. Selecting the right ReactJS development company is crucial to ensure the success of your project. Here are some key considerations to keep in mind when making this important decision.

**Expertise and Experience:**

The first and foremost factor to consider is the expertise and experience of the development company. Look for a team that has a proven track record of successfully delivering ReactJS projects. Check their portfolio to see if they have worked on projects similar to yours and inquire about the technologies and tools they have expertise in.

**Technical Proficiency:**

A reliable ReactJS development company should have a deep understanding of the React ecosystem, including Redux, GraphQL, and other related technologies. They should be well-versed in the latest trends and best practices in ReactJS development to ensure that your project is built using the most efficient and effective techniques.

**Customization and Flexibility:**

Each project has its own unique requirements and challenges. A good ReactJS development company should be able to customize their approach to suit your specific needs. They should be flexible enough to adapt to changes and be willing to provide solutions tailored to your business goals and objectives.

**Communication and Collaboration:**

Effective communication is essential for the success of any development project. A reputable ReactJS development company should prioritize clear and transparent communication throughout the development process. They should be easily accessible and responsive to your queries and concerns. Look for a team that values collaboration and keeps you involved at every stage of the project.

**Quality Assurance and Testing:**

Quality assurance is crucial to ensure that your application is robust, secure, and performs well under all conditions. A reliable ReactJS development company should have a comprehensive testing process in place to identify and fix any issues before the final deployment. Ask about their quality assurance practices and how they ensure the reliability and stability of the applications they develop.

**Client Reviews and Testimonials:**

Before making a final decision, consider checking the client reviews and testimonials of the ReactJS development company. Feedback from previous clients can provide valuable insights into their work ethics, project management skills, and overall performance.


Choosing the right ReactJS development company can significantly impact the success of your project. By considering factors such as expertise, technical proficiency, customization, communication, quality assurance, and client reviews, you can make an informed decision that aligns with your project requirements and goals. Investing time and effort in selecting the best development partner will ultimately contribute to the creation of a high-quality, scalable, and user-friendly ReactJS application that meets your business objectives and delights your users.

